IELTS Test Formats
IELTS uses two test formats to cater to various requirements:
Test FormatDescriptionIELTS AcademicCreated for people seeking college, concentrating on the language abilities needed for a scholastic environment.IELTS General TrainingTailored for those seeking to work, train, or move to English-speaking nations, emphasizing practical language skills in daily contexts.Secret Components of the IELTS TestElementDurationDescriptionListening30 minutesFour taped segments including a range of accents; includes conversations, monologues, and discussions.Reading60 minutes3 areas with various types of texts; Academic includes texts from books and journals, while General Training consists of extracts from ads and manuals.Composing60 minutesTwo jobs; Academic needs a report and an essay, while General Training needs a letter and an essay.Speaking11-- 14 minutesA face-to-face interview with an inspector, including three parts: introduction, a long turn, and a discussion.Scoring Criteria

Q1: How typically can I take the IELTS exam?
A1: You can take the IELTS exam as lot of times as you wish. Nevertheless, it is suggested to allow adequate time for preparation before retaking the test.
Q2: How long are IELTS scores legitimate?
A2: IELTS scores are typically valid for two years from the test date. After that, they are thought about expired for admission or immigration purposes.
Q3: Can I alter my test date?
A3: Yes, candidates can alter their test date but should do so a minimum of 5 weeks before the scheduled date. A fee might apply.
Q4: Is there a minimum age requirement for taking the IELTS?
A4: The minimum age requirement is 16 years. Nevertheless, some universities may have higher age requirements for admission.
